Starting Online therapy

What is online therapy?

With Thriveworks, Online therapy is an effective alternative to in-person therapy services in which a client can speak to a Thriveworks therapist remotely via online video conferencing. Online sessions are just as effective as in-person treatment, but they can also provide added benefits like reduced travel time, saving money on transportation or childcare, and increased access to care.

How does online therapy work?

Online therapy works much like traditional in-person therapy but takes place through secure video conferencing. Clients can attend Online therapy from any safe place they choose that has access to the internet, whether that be their home or another easily accessible place. Like in-person treatment, a therapist will work with their client to address their concerns, create goals, and establish an effective treatment plan.

How long does online therapy last?

Online therapy can last for a few months to years depending on the goals and symptoms of the client. The treatment process will be unique to each client and lend itself to their specific concerns, which means that the time it takes to treat them will always be different. Timing is also up to the client themselves; they are free to stop therapy whenever they please, especially if they feel they have reached their goals and addressed their concerns.

Is Online Counseling Effective?

Online counseling has been proven just as effective as in-person counseling, aka face to face counseling. Online counselors and therapists at Thriveworks in Oklahoma City, OK are fully licensed and can conduct comprehensive, high-quality sessions via a secure telehealth connection. Some clients even prefer online therapy because they can do it from the comfort of their own homes. Thriveworks online counseling clients can also benefit from these virtual therapy services in the following ways:

  • They have more scheduling flexibility, like booking sessions on evenings and weekends.
  • They may not need to hire babysitters or take time off work to attend sessions.
  • They can do sessions while they’re traveling for work or pleasure. 
  • They can do group therapy without needing to rearrange everyone’s schedule to be in the same place at the same time.  
  • They may feel safer discussing intimate matters from familiar surroundings.
  • They get more specialized provider options because they’re not limited by geography. 
  • They can attend sessions even if they or their therapist worries about spreading germs.
  • They don’t involve a waiting room.
  • They allow sessions even when you have mobility issues from a physical disability or an emotional/behavioral issue. 
  • They can still have top-rated therapy sessions even if they reside in rural or remote areas.
  • They can enjoy a greater degree of privacy and anonymity by not having to go to a clinic in-person.
  • They benefit from a secure, HIPAA-compliant online therapy platform that allows them to video-conference with their therapist face-to-face and reap all the benefits of nonverbal communication.

Where Can I Find an Online Psychiatrist?

Thriveworks psychiatrists in Oklahoma, OK can meet with clients online to diagnose, treat, and help prevent mental health conditions like depression and anxiety. Psychiatrists are medical doctors who can prescribe medication and manage prescription drugs like antidepressants. Thriveworks online psychiatrists (telepsychiatrists) offer a full suite of specialized services online, and clients never need to leave their homes to benefit. 

Can Couples Do Online Marriage Counseling?

Licensed counselors and therapists at Thriveworks in Oklahoma, OK can facilitate online counseling sessions for couples and family members. Many of the therapeutic exercises that work so well in person can be adapted to work just as well online. Plus they work well for family members who live far away from each other, for example if a child is at college.
